vocab ppt-10
vocabulary
| Question | Answer |
|---|---|
| Accessible | Content that can be viewed by a wide variety of computer users, including those who may have disabilities that require them to use adaptive technologies such as screen reading programs. |
| Comment | A note you insert on a slide while reviewing. |
| encrypting | The process of transforming data into a non-readable form for security purposes. |
| mark as final | A setting that prevents changes from being made to a presentation unless the user chooses to acknowledge the warning and edit it anyway, does not provide security. |
| markup | The changes identified between two versions of a presentation when using compare. |
| null string | blank, with no characters or spaces. |
| Opendocument | A file format that most word processing programs support, including the free openoffice suite. |
| Password | A word or phrase that you must type for access to an encrypted file. |

| Picture presentation | a presentation that consists of a series of full-screen graphics of slide content, placed on blank slide backgrounds |
| Platform-independent | able to be used on a variety of operating systems. |
| Powerpoint show | a presentation that opens default in slide show view. |
| rich text format(RTF) | a text file format that most word processing programs can open and save as. |
| Windows movie video(wmv) | the format that powerpoint saves to when creating videos from presentation files. |
